Property Location
With a stay at Jetty Motel in Cape May (Cape May Historic District), you'll be steps from Cape May Beach and 11 minutes by foot from Washington Street Mall. This beach hotel is 8.3 mi (13.3 km) from Wildwood Boardwalk and 13.5 mi (21.7 km) from Wildwood Beach.

Rooms
Make yourself at home in one of the 35 guestrooms featuring refrigerators.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ms with bathtubs or showers are provided.

Amenities
Take advantage of recreation opportunities such as an outdoor pool, or other amenities including complimentary wireless internet access and a vending machine.

Business, Other Amenities
The front desk is staffed during limited hours. Free self parking is available onsite.

Dirty, Dirty Carpet We stayed here last year at the end of the season to give it a try. It has a great location directly across from our favorite beach. Our stay was "okay", so we booked for several days this July (2024). We were extremely disappointed. First, we were told on the phone when I made the reservation that we could not check in until 4pm and that they were very strict with the times. which was very inconvenient. We waited until 4pm and then checked in. The next day we noticed a LOT of people arriving, some prior to noon, and checking in. I asked in the office why we couldn't check in until 4pm. They said "oh you could have". So why were we told diffent? They didn't know why we were told that. Enter the room. The room smelled clean, heavy on the bleach but we felt assured the room had been cleaned. Yeah, not so much. The worst discovery was after we were walking around the room the next day in our bare feet. On initial glance the rug appeared "newer". But it was filthy dirty. Our feet were black from the ground in dirt in the carpet. In the light of day you could clearly see the path of grime from the door through the room. We bought a pair of flip flops to wear in there. I spoke to the person in the office and mentioned the carpet. They weren't very concerned with my complaint. She said the carpet was cleaned at the beginning of the season. I told them I wanted to speak with the owner or manager. I was told they would call me. That never happened. I would not recommend the "Jetty Motel" for multiple reasons. Conflicting check in instructions, dirty carpet, kitchenette barely stocked with dishes and flatware, sheets so worn you can see through them and they didn't fit the mattress very well. Oh, built up nasty grime in the bathroom. Photos attached don't fully show the condition of this room. The only thing this place has going for it is location and they charge way too much for that. We travel a lot and I do a lot of reviews. Some things can be tolerated but this was beyond acceptable. We've been going to Cape May several times a year for many years and have stayed at multiple places. Never seen anything like this.
